Comfort Food
Comfort food is food that provides a nostalgic or sentimental value to someone, and may be characterized by its high caloric nature, high carbohydrate level, or simple preparation. The nostalgia may be specific to an individual, or it may apply to a specific culture. (Wikipedia)
The food in the picture at the top is called Mac'n'Cheese. That is short for Macaroni and Cheese. It can also be called KD. 'KD' stands for Kraft Dinner, which is probably the most common brand of Macaroni and Cheese. This is a classic comfort food for Canadian and American kids. It is simple to make, tastes good, and brings back positive memories from childhood - that is what makes it a comfort food.
